What are the opening hours of Outback Steakhouse Grand Junction?
Outback Steakhouse is open Wednesday through Sunday. Hours are 11:00 AM to 9:30 PM Wednesday and Thursday, 11:00 AM to 10:00 PM Friday and Saturday, and 11:00 AM to 9:00 PM Sunday. The restaurant is closed Monday and Tuesday.
Does Outback Steakhouse Grand Junction offer delivery and pickup options?
Yes, they offer in-store pickup, curbside pickup, delivery, same-day delivery, and no-contact delivery services.
Where is Outback Steakhouse located in Grand Junction?
Outback Steakhouse is located at 2432 Highway 6 & 50, Grand Junction, CO 81505, in front of Cabela's Sporting Goods.
Can I find gluten-free options at Outback Steakhouse Grand Junction?
Yes, they have several gluten-free menu items. You can view their gluten-free menu online via the provided link.
What payment methods are accepted at Outback Steakhouse Grand Junction?
They accept American Express, cash, MasterCard, and Visa.
Is there a bar available at Outback Steakhouse Grand Junction?
Yes, they have an onsite bar serving liquor, beer, wine, and cocktails.
Does Outback Steakhouse Grand Junction have facilities for families and accessibility features?
Yes, the restaurant welcomes families, has child seating like high chairs, wheelchair accessible parking and seating, wheelchair accessible restrooms, and even a braille menu.
